Q3 Planning Note — Pilot Churn

Heads of department: churn in the Bramleigh pilot hit 14%, double forecast. Exit interviews cite onboarding friction and slow support response. Actions: shorten setup flow, add dedicated pilot support rota, review pricing tier fit by mid-quarter. Retention owner: Dalen, reporting weekly. Strategic implications for the wider rollout are summarised in the confidential note below.

internal memo for kawip-hadug: Headcount on the Wenwyn team goes from 7 to 140 by the end of January. Gross margin on Wenwyn came in at 20 percent against a plan of 15 percent.

Q: Why did my weather alert fan-out stall after the Stormline release?
A: The fan-out queue pauses when the Pellbrook region shard reports lag over 30s. Releases that touch the notifier reset shard cursors, which looks like a stall for up to five minutes. Check the shard lag panel before rolling back. If lag persists past ten minutes, contact the fan-out maintainers at the address below.

alerts address for tageg-kahof: fenath@sivrellabs.test

Vendor note for new team members: canary gating on the Bramblewick platform is enforced by our vendor, Opaline Systems, not by us. Their Gatewright tool holds each canary at 5% traffic until error rate, latency p95, and saturation all pass for 30 minutes. We cannot override the hold; only Opaline's release desk can. Document any gating dispute in the vendor log before requesting an exception. For exception requests, write to their release desk directly.

alerts address for bahaf-kaduf: zorox@qorvelio.internal

MEMO — To the Board of Ostley Motors
From: Grenna Falsh, VP Aftersales

Heads up on a less-than-fun number: warranty costs on the Tilvern compact line have run about 30% over provision this year. The main culprit is a door-seal defect that our Harwick plant has since fixed, but vehicles already in the field keep generating claims. We've tightened the repair protocol and renegotiated parts pricing, which should blunt the overrun by year-end. Fuller financial detail comes at the next board pack. Our intended strategic response is outlined below.

board note of tadup-tajog: Headcount on the Oliiel team goes from 31 to 88 by the end of February. Gross margin on Oliiel came in at 62 percent against a plan of 29 percent.